Kamloops Long Blades Awarded $10,000 Intact Insurance Club Excellence Award
The Kamloops Long Blades Association are winners of this year’s Intact Insurance Club Excellence Award and will received a $10,000 grand prize to support a project that aims to welcome new Canadians to their club.
